Hi All

I am using AM3517 in a Tablet design.

I want to interface a NAND flash, but most NAND flash with 1-bit ecc are obsolete. Hence this option does not seem feasible to me.

i tried to look for e-MMC devices, All of them are on version 4.41 and AM3517 has mmc version 4.2.

I have confirmed from various vendors of e-MMC version 4.41 is NOT backward compatible to 4.2.

and Now, i have no clue What is the easiest flash interface to use with AM3517.

  • Kshitij,

    There's another thread on this forum - "AM3517 - eMMC Flash Boot Mode".  You will find the following information there:

                        You should be able to boot from the v4.41 device, you just will not be able to use the added features for 4.41.  

    When the memory manufacturers say "NOT backward compatible", they mean that you can't use v4.41 "mode" to operate a 4.2 device.  However, 4.41 memory devices can still be operated as if they are 4.2 devices.
